IMPACT Results – 9/28/23; Current lineup for Bound For Glory

Coming out of Thursday night’s episode of IMPACT Wrestling on AXS TV is the following for the Bound For Glory PPV on Saturday, October 21.

IMPACT World Championship Match: Alex Shelley (c) defends against Josh Alexander

-IMPACT Knockouts World Championship Match: Trinity defends against Mickie James

-IMPACT X-DIVISION Championship Match: Chris Sabin defends against KENTA

-Will Ospreay vs. Mike Bailey

X-Division Champion Chris Sabin vs Alan Angels – X-Division Championship

After becoming #1 Contender in Ultimate X last week, Alan Angels challenges Chris Sabin for the X-Division Title! Angels targets the left arm of Sabin, as he delivers a double stomp from the top rope. Sabin breaks free of an armbar attempt, but Angels drives him into the top turnbuckle instead. Sabin creates some much-needed separation with an explosive dropkick. Sabin quickens the pace, delivering a series of strikes to Angels. Sabin hits a running boot in the corner but Angels counters the follow-up tornado DDT. The referee prevents Angels from using the X-Division Title belt as a weapon. Angels hits a low blow, followed by the Halo Strike but it’s not enough. Angels misses a splash attempt, allowing Sabin to caplitalize with a missle dropkick. Sabin hits the Cradle Shock to win.

X-Division Champion Chris Sabin def Alan Angels – X-Division Championship

After the match, it is revealed that KENTA will make his long-awaited IMPACT return at Bound For Glory and it appears that he has his sights set on the X-Division Championship.

Yuya Uemura’s Goodbye Ceremony

After receiving the pink slip in Feast or Fired, Yuya Uemura will be fired from IMPACT Wrestling tonight. Uemura is joined by his tag team partner in JOYA, Joe Hendry, as they make their way to the ring. Hendry gets on the mic and says that despite what happened, he has to be thankful for the memories he shared with Uemura. Hendry starts a “Thank You Yuya” chant and the fans join in. Uemura is about to address the crowd when the IMPACT World Tag Team Champions, the Rascalz, interrupt. Trey Miguel and Zachary Wentz poke fun at the situation, and claim that if even if JOYA earned an IMPACT World Tag Team Title opportunity, they would fail. Hendry and Uemura bring the fight to the Rascalz when Director of Authority Santino Marella interrupts. Marella announces a match pitting JOYA vs the Rascalz – and if JOYA wins, Uemura gets to keep his job!

IMPACT World Tag Team Champions The Rascalz (Trey Miguel & Zachary Wentz) vs JOYA (Joe Hendry & Yuya Uemura) – If JOYA Wins, Yuya Uemura Keeps His Job

Hendry delivers a series of chops to the chest of Wentz. Hendry hits Wentz with a stalling suplex for two. Wentz rakes Uemura’s eyes in the corner but Uemura comes back with a double dropkick to both members of the Rascalz. Miguel evades the One Hit Wonder, then sends Hendry crashing into his own partner. Minutes later, Wentz attempts a handspring but Uemura cuts him off with a dropkick. Uemura makes the tag to Hendry as the pace quickens. Hendry puts his strength on display as he suplexes Miguel and Wentz at the same time. Wentz almost puts Hendry away with a double foot stomp from the top rope. JOYA hits the One Hit Wonder on Wentz but it’s not enough to keep him down. JOYA hits another One Hit Wonder, this time on Miguel, but Wentz pulls him to safety on the pin. Hendry chases Wentz up the ramp. Meanwhile, Miguel goes low on Uemura, then blinds him with spray paint. Miguel rolls up Uemura to steal the victory, bringing his time with IMPACT to an end.

IMPACT World Tag Team Champions The Rascalz (Trey Miguel & Zachary Wentz) def JOYA (Joe Hendry & Yuya Uemura) – If JOYA Wins, Yuya Uemura Keeps His Job

Knockouts World Champion Trinity vs Gisele Shaw w/ Savannah Evans & Jai Vidal

Gisele Shaw looks to make a statement against the reigning Knockouts World Champion, Trinity! The early advantage goes to Trinity as she has some fun at the expense of her opponent. Trinity hits a running clothesline, then sends her to the outside with a dropkick. Shaw catches Trinity in mid-air and whips her into the steel ring steps. Trinity makes it back into the ring at the referee’s count of nine. Shaw is in total control as she knees Trinity from the top rope, driving her face-first into the mat. Trinity creates an opening with a big springboard kick. Trinity continues to build momentum with a Samoan Drop for two. Trinity leaps off the second rope, almost putting Shaw away with a crossbody. Shaw counters an Enzuigiri into Shock & Awe for another near fall. Trinity avoids the Denouement, then spikes Shaw into the canvas. Jai Vidal inadvertently trips up Shaw from the outside. Trinity locks in Star Struck to win by submission.

Knockouts World Champion Trinity def Gisele Shaw w/ Savannah Evans & Jai Vidal

After the bell, Savannah Evans and Jai Vidal attack Trinity but Mickie James runs down to make the save. James and Trinity join forces to clear the ring. James grabs a mic and tells Trinity that she’ll always have her back. James praises Trinity for not only winning the Knockouts World Championship, but earning it. James reminds Trinity that she never lost the Knockouts World Title and she has a rematch clause that can be invoked whenever she wants. James reveals that her rematch will take place at the biggest event of the year, Bound For Glory!
